Web4 jun. 2024 · One way that you can extend your tomato plant’s life is by picking the fruits of the vine just before they start to ripen. Tomato plants use quite a lot of energy during their fruit-bearing stage, and removing the fruits early can conserve your plant’s energy to continue growing.

Web2 mrt. 2024 · Don't plant out tomatoes until temperatures in early summer have risen, especially at night. If in doubt, plant the tomatoes into generous-sized pots so the roots have plenty of room to grow and stand them outside on warm days, bringing them indoors when the temperatures drop. Web14 nov. 2024 · You first need to stop watering your tomato if you believe it has been overwatered. Allow your tomato to dry before watering it again. Move your plants to a warm, sunny location if they are in pots or containers so they can dry out. You can also aerate the soil if they are in the ground to aid in its drying.

Web7 apr. 2024 · To grow tomatoes successfully, you need rich, fertile soil or peat-free potting compost, and a good sunny, sheltered spot. Water regularly and feed weekly with a high-potash fertiliser once the plants start to flower. Tomatoes are split into two main growing types: determinate (bush) and indeterminate (cordon).
